A 50-year-old farmer died after collapsing while waiting at a petrol station in Khanasama upazila of Dinajpur district, Bangladesh, in an incident that occurred during a period of heavy congestion at the site.
The deceased, identified as Masud Rana, was the son of Mofiz Uddin and a resident of the Sathi Para area of Darowani in Sonaray Union under Nilphamari Sadar upazila. He had travelled to the filling station by motorcycle to collect fuel.
The incident took place on Monday at approximately 5:00 pm at the Umar Faruq Filling Station, located adjacent to the Chowrongi market area in Khanasama upazila. According to eyewitness accounts, a long queue had formed at the station, with at least 200 motorcycles waiting for fuel prior to the arrival of a fuel tanker. The tanker reached the station at around 4:30 pm, after which fuel distribution began.
Masud Rana was reportedly standing near the entrance of the petrol station with his motorcycle rather than in the main queue when he suddenly experienced dizziness and fell to the ground. People present at the scene immediately assisted him and transported him by van to the Khanasama Upazila Health Complex in the Pakarhat area for emergency medical attention.
On arrival at the health facility, attending medical staff confirmed that he was already dead. The confirmation was provided by Community Medical Officer Mahfuz Al Mamun Siddiki, who stated that the patient had been brought in deceased.
Following the incident, Khanasama Police Station took necessary steps after being informed at approximately 5:15 pm. The Officer-in-Charge, Abdul Baset Sardar, confirmed that police personnel were dispatched to the scene shortly after receiving the report. He further stated that the deceased’s relatives later collected the body and that no formal complaint had been lodged in connection with the incident.
The circumstances surrounding the sudden collapse were not detailed in official statements, and no additional medical explanation was provided at the time of reporting. The incident occurred during a routine fuel distribution period at the station, which had drawn a large number of motorcyclists due to the arrival of the fuel tanker.
